mariadb/mysql-test/suite/sql_sequence/aria.test
Lena Startseva 9854fb6fa7 MDEV-31003: Second execution for ps-protocol
This patch adds for "--ps-protocol" second execution
of queries "SELECT".
Also in this patch it is added ability to disable/enable
(--disable_ps2_protocol/--enable_ps2_protocol) second
execution for "--ps-prototocol" in testcases.
2023-07-26 17:15:00 +07:00

45 lines
900 B
Text

--source include/have_sequence.inc
--source include/have_aria.inc
#
# Simple test of the aria engine
# As most test is above the engine, we only have to test base functionality
#
set @@default_storage_engine="aria";
--disable_ps2_protocol
CREATE SEQUENCE t1 cache=10;
show create sequence t1;
select NEXT VALUE for t1,seq from seq_1_to_20;
select * from t1;
drop sequence t1;
#
# Create and check
#
create sequence s1;
check table s1;
select next value for s1;
flush tables;
check table s1;
select next value for s1;
flush tables;
repair table s1;
select next value for s1;
drop sequence s1;
#
# ALTER and RENAME
CREATE SEQUENCE t1;
--error ER_SEQUENCE_INVALID_DATA
alter sequence t1 minvalue=100;
alter sequence t1 minvalue=100 start=100 restart=100;
rename table t1 to t2;
select next value for t2;
alter table t2 rename to t1;
select next value for t1;
drop table t1;
--enable_ps2_protocol